Polo Shirt Go-To Guide: Picking Polos For Work, Teams And Brandwear

Polos are the quiet workhorse of branded clothing.

A good polo can bridge the gap between smart and practical. It works in a showroom, on a site visit, at an event or behind a counter. A poor polo goes baggy, twists, fades or feels awful after a few washes.

Start by deciding whether the garment needs to feel corporate, rugged, lightweight, easy-care or budget-friendly. The right polo depends on the job.

What matters most

  • Fabric: cotton-rich feels natural, polyester blends can dry faster and keep shape well.
  • Collar structure: a tired collar makes the whole garment look tired.
  • Sizing: polos often need careful size advice across mixed teams.
  • Decoration: left breast embroidery is a classic for a reason, but print can work well for bolder designs.

Best use cases

Polos are ideal for trade teams, sales teams, hospitality, events, clubs and general business uniform. If you are building a first uniform, polos are often the simplest place to start.
